1. History of Oil Pulling

Originating from ancient Ayurvedic medicine, oil pulling has been practiced for thousands of years. This traditional technique was used in India to promote oral health and overall wellness. The term "oil pulling" comes from the process of "pulling" the oil through the gaps in the teeth, which is believed to draw out toxins and harmful bacteria from the mouth.

Historically, various oils have been used for this practice, including sesame oil and coconut oil. Over time, modern variations have emerged, with products like Gurunanda oil pulling using a blend of oils and essential ingredients to enhance effectiveness and flavor.

4. How to Oil Pull with Gurunanda

Incorporating Gurunanda oil pulling into your daily routine is simple and effective. Follow these steps for the best results:

  1. Measure the desired amount of Gurunanda oil pulling product (usually 1 tablespoon).
  2. Swish the oil in your mouth for 10-20 minutes, ensuring it passes through your teeth.
  3. Spit the oil into a trash can (not the sink to avoid clogging).
  4. Rinse your mouth with warm water and brush your teeth afterward.

For optimal results, consider oil pulling first thing in the morning on an empty stomach.

5. Best Oils for Oil Pulling

While Gurunanda is a popular choice, there are other oils that can be used for oil pulling. Here are some of the best options:

  • Coconut Oil: Rich in lauric acid, it has potent antibacterial properties.
  • Sesame Oil: Traditionally used in oil pulling, it provides numerous health benefits.
  • Sunflower Oil: A lighter option that is also effective for oil pulling.

6. Common Misconceptions About Oil Pulling

Despite its growing popularity, there are several misconceptions about oil pulling that need to be addressed:

  • Oil Pulling Replaces Brushing: Oil pulling should complement, not replace, regular brushing and flossing.
  • Immediate Results: While some may notice benefits quickly, consistent practice is key for lasting effects.
  • All Oils Are Equal: Different oils offer varying benefits; choose high-quality oils for the best results.

7. Scientific Evidence Supporting Oil Pulling

Research on oil pulling has shown promising results in improving oral health. Various studies indicate that oil pulling can reduce plaque and gingivitis significantly. For example, a study published in the "Journal of Clinical Dentistry" demonstrated that oil pulling with sesame oil effectively reduced plaque and bacteria.

Furthermore, another study highlighted the potential of coconut oil in reducing harmful bacteria in the mouth, supporting the effectiveness of Gurunanda oil pulling products.

8. Frequently Asked Questions

Is oil pulling safe?

Yes, oil pulling is generally safe for most individuals. However, those with specific health conditions or concerns should consult a healthcare professional before starting.

How often should I oil pull?

For optimal results, it is recommended to oil pull daily, preferably in the morning.

Can children do oil pulling?

Oil pulling can be safe for children, but it is essential to supervise them and ensure they understand not to swallow the oil.

How long does it take to see results?

While some may notice improvements within a few days, significant benefits may take several weeks of consistent practice.
